Bears is an interesting series of images I stumbled on tonight. Kent Rogowski disassembles stuffed teddy-bears, turns them inside-out, and then re-stuffs them. I’m not one for studio work, but I think it works for these images since they are primarily conceptual.

See for yourself.

Also, if you’re in New York he has a show up at the Foley Gallery.
